Foreign Minister of Belarus Vladimir Makei paid an official visit to Iraq, BelTA reports. It was the first visit of the Belarusian delegation of such a level to Iraq since 2003. Foreign Minister of Belarus met with the President of Iraq Muhammad Fuad Masum. The President of Iraq hailed the visit of the Head of the Belarusian Foreign Ministry as a signal of support for the Iraqi leadership in the fight against extremists. “Vladimir Makei condemned the actions of terrorist groups, which led to widespread casualties among the Iraqi population. The Minister confirmed Belarus’ readiness to expand all-round partnership with Iraq.
At the meetings with Acting Prime Minister of Iraq Nouri Kamil al-Maliki and Designate Prime Minister of Iraq Haider Al-Abadi Vladimir Makei focused on possible ways to enhance trade and economic cooperation between the two countries.
Ambassador of Belarus to Iraq Andrei Savinyh comments on the prospects of our dialogue with Iraq:

“We would like Iraq to be a united country. And we would definitely like to see peace in Iraq. It’s hard to say when this becomes possible, but we are ready to apply efforts to restore peace in the country and help Iraq revive its economy.
We intend further move ahead in developing bilateral contacts and economic cooperation. We will do it cautiously of course, and with regard to realities of the day. But this movement will be steady and stable.”
